E- Trading UI Developer


CHARLOTTE, NC

Job Ref ID: 484241000006892698

  • Job Type: Full time
  • Number of Positions: (1)

Job Description

Electronic Trading UI developer
Job Location a. NYC/NJ/Charlotte
Travel Requirements a. 10% of the total time, between NYC/NJ/Charlotte.

Job Division
a. Multi-Asset Electronic Trading Group
b. Electronic Trading UI Development Team

Job Description
a. Hands-on development role in building high performant Electronic trading UIs.
b. Architect, design, and develop, unit and stress test high performing data rich UI screens/widgets/frameworks that are integrated well in to the entire electronic trading stack.
c. Involves building high performant market data UIs, Trader blotters, RFQ negotiation UIs, Offer Management UIs, Alert Notifications and Pricing/What If Scenario analysis UIs.
d. Will be a key participant in a small, focused and highly talented delivery team for front office trading UI development.
e. Great opportunities exist across multiple asset-classes, Fixed Income, Foreign Exchange, Equities, and build one common UI code base for entire Electronic Trading technology stack.
f. Design and develop extreme automated stress testing harnesses.
g. Delve into hardware tuning for high end electronic trading UI.
h. Participate in and conduct code review sessions, and provide process improvements.
i. Domain expertise in Macro, Spread and/or Equities, coupled with hands-on experience in building electronic trading UI frameworks and/or Capital Market’s widgets is a huge plus.


Requirements

Must have Qualities
a. Experienced in building high performant market data UIs, Trader/Execution blotters, RFQ negotiation UIs, Offer Management UIs, Alert Notifications and Pricing/What If Scenario analysis UIs.
b. High performance programming techniques in JavaScript using Angular.
c. Ability to evaluate new technologies; ability to conduct enterprise wide research.
d. Experienced in building user friendly & ergonomic UIs.
e. Good understanding and working knowledge of core technology concepts in like networking, multi-threading, synchronization, data structures, algorithms, memory management, etc.
f. Experienced in diagnosing performance bottlenecks and performance tuning.
g. Windows/Linux programming environment familiarity.

Good to Have
a. Knowledge and implementation of multiple UI development Languages (Python, .Net, React JS)
b. Domain expertise in building front office trading UIs using OpenFin Framework.
c. Domain expertise in Fixed Income, FX and/or Equities, coupled with hands-on experience in building electronic trading UI and Frameworks is a huge plus.
d. Prior experience in building high throughput, low latency electronic trading front-end applications.
e. Data modeling experience.
f. Extensive experience in the capital markets business and processes, e.g. trade lifecycle, electronic trading/algorithmic trading.
g. Strong verbal and written communication skills.
h. Good understanding and/or working knowledge of Compliance and Regulatory needs in building capital markets electronic trading front end applications.

Educational Requirements – Bachelor/Master degree in Computer Science/Engineering.

Share This Job

Apply Now